The Executive Development Programme in Gaming Regulation for the Future is a certificate course designed to provide learners with a comprehensive understanding of the gaming industry and the regulatory frameworks that govern it. This programme is crucial for professionals looking to advance their careers in this rapidly evolving sector, as it offers in-depth knowledge of the latest trends, challenges, and opportunities in gaming regulation.

Course Details


Game Development Landscape and Regulatory Challenges

Emerging Technologies in Gaming: Virtual Reality, Augmented Reality, and Artificial Intelligence

Understanding Gambling Addiction, Player Protection, and Responsible Gaming Measures

Legal Framework and Jurisdictional Issues in Gaming Regulation

Regulatory Compliance and Enforcement Strategies for Online Gaming Platforms

Risk Management and Financial Crimes in Gaming Industry: Money Laundering, Fraud, and Taxation

Ethical Considerations and Social Responsibility in Gaming Regulation

Innovative Approaches to Gaming Regulation: Self-Regulation, Co-Regulation, and Multi-Stakeholder Collaboration

Future Trends in Gaming Regulation and Policy-Making
